StudyQuiz has continued to evolve since v1.2.1. This release combines new quiz-building functionality with a significant amount of work behind the scenes: mobile responsiveness, AI usage controls, database migrations, SEO improvements, and stronger automated testing. The goal has been to make StudyQuiz easier to use while also improving the engineering foundations needed to keep developing it reliably. What’s New Manual Quiz Builder, including form-based quiz creation and the ability to add new questions Daily AI usage tracking and limits for AI-generated quizzes Waiting-list and launch-plan infrastructure Module rename and delete functionality Resend confirmation email functionality Restrictions preventing unverified users from creating or modifying modules and quizzes SEO metadata and sitemap support for public pages Improved Improved AI-generated quiz creation experience Improved module page UX Improved mobile responsiveness across the homepage, login page, dashboard, modules, quiz attempts, and AI quiz generation Improved handling of AI usage-limit errors Improved authentication and database connection reliability Expanded integration and unit test coverage Improved CI support for external contributors and fork-based pull requests Infrastructure One of the bigger changes in this release happened behind the UI. StudyQuiz now uses Alembic for database migrations, replacing the previous approach of manually keeping database schemas synchronized. Database migrations are also integrated into the GitHub Actions test workflow, helping ensure that schema changes work correctly on a fresh database before they reach production. I also reorganised the automated tests and expanded CI coverage across more backend workflows. Mobile and SEO A substantial part of this release focused on making StudyQuiz work better outside desktop-sized screens. The homepage, login page, user dashboard, module pages, quiz attempts, and AI quiz-generation flow have all received responsive layout improvements. Public pages also now have page-specific metadata, sitemap support, canonical URL improvements, and appropriate indexing rules for pages such as login and privacy. Why This Release Matters v1.3.0 is less about one headline feature and more about moving StudyQuiz from an early MVP towards a more mature and maintainable production application. The Manual Quiz Builder expands how quizzes can be created, while AI usage controls establish the foundations for managing limited AI resources. At the same time, database migrations, automated tests, CI improvements, SEO work, and mobile support make the application easier to operate and safer to continue developing. The project is also now better prepared for external contributions, with CI improvements that allow integration tests to run correctly from contributor forks.
